Abstract

To survey on population dynamics of Indian Mackerel, (Rastrelliger kanagurta, Cuvier 1817) in the Persian Gulf and Oman Sea random sampling was carried out monthly from November 2012 to October 2013. Length frequency data were recorded randomly from Bandar Abbas and Qeshm Island landing monthly. A totally of 2340 individuals were recorded for length frequency thorough, 525 fish were recorded for length- weight relationship. The average total length (TL) of Indian mackerel was calculated 23.6±2.2, with a range of 13.9 to 35.5 centimeters. The length-weight relationship was determined as W= 0.0061FL 3.27, and it showed an isometric growth pattern. The asymptotic length (L) and growth coefficient (K) were estimated as 44.2(cm) and 0.64(yr-1), respectively. The value of to was calculated -0.2, and the longevity was estimated 4.38 years. The growth equation of Von Bertalanffy was obtained at L (t) = 44.2(1- exp (-0.64(t-(-0.2))) for Indian mackerel. Maximum recruitment was in June at 16.2 percent.  Total mortality (Z) rate was estimated 3.38 (yr-1) on Length-converted catch curve method. The rates of natural mortality (M) on Pauly's empirical equation, fishing mortality (F) and exploitation ratio were estimated 1.29 (yr-1), 2.09 (yr-1) and 0.62, respectively.
